Does your company currently use a standalone HRIS with separate payroll software? After all, both HR and payroll systems manage a lot of the same data, so why enter data twice when you can input it into a single shared database? Direct deposit works through the Automated Clearing House (ACH) network—you instruct your bank to prepare a payroll file and it disburses employees’ pay electronically to their banks.
